Postcode EN5 1EX is located in a major urban area, within the Barnet Vale ward of Barnet in the London region, and forms part of the Oakleigh Park area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 21.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 84%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Oakleigh Park is £85,647 per year. The nearest station is Totteridge and Whetstone, about 0.7 miles away. There are 7 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There are 6 parks nearby, the closest large park is Brook Farm Open Space.
Oakleigh Park has a very low level of deprivation, ranked at position 28,338 out of 32,844 areas in England, placing it within the bottom 14% least deprived areas in England.
Oakleigh Park has a very low crime rate, with approximately 21.4 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 0.8%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 6.0% of dwellings are socially rented.

High noise level (70.0-74.9 dB) from road, approximately 316 ft away from EN5 1EX.
Oakleigh Park near EN5 1EX has no flood risk (less than 0.1%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
